High Speed Production Duplication of Memory Flash CardsThe M6550MC is made up of one to four sections of eight sockets each. Each section has its own powerful Pentium IV computer running Linux. The sections are networked together using a high speed multi-port Ethernet switch so that all sections may share a common control window. Once a duplication job is launched in the user friendly GUI window, each section is individually started using the sections' START Key.Because each section is a separate computer with parallel processing of the copy and verify data to all up to sixty-four copy sockets, while any section is being unloaded and then loaded, the other three sections can be performing a copy function. This sequential operation of each section allows maximum throughput for the system.Included Front Panel Functions for Each Section
